
Vegancooooch
Channel
4646 video views
46 views
12
12
Make ART. Make LOVE. Make MONEY.
+

Country: USA
Profile hits: 257
Subscribers: 12
Total video views: 46
Languages: English
Signed up: June 1, 2025 (24 days ago)
Last activity: today